Funeral services for Ms. Billie Eugenia Hunt, affectionately known as Billie Jean, age 69, of Monroe, Louisiana, will be held at 11:00AM Wednesday, October 22, 2025, in the chapel of Mulhearn Funeral Home Sterlington Rd. Monroe, LA, with Rev. Warren Eckhardt officiating. Interment will follow at Mulhearn Memorial Park Cemetery. Visitation will be from 5:00PM until 7:00PM Tuesday, October 21, 2025, at the funeral home.
Ms. Hunt passed away peacefully on October 18, 2025, surrounded by love from her children — Veronica and her husband, Taylor, and Ellis and his wife, Alexis.
A proud graduate of Wossman High School, Class of 1974, Ms. Hunt was a member of the school’s dance team. In her early years, she worked diligently cleaning for Mulhearn Funeral Home, Cypress Street Church of God, and many other local businesses and families. She also served as a teller for a local bank and consultant for a local insurance company and faithfully delivered newspapers for The News-Star for many years.
This past year, Billie Jean joyfully celebrated her 50th class reunion with her sister, Mary Sue, and had the best time reconnecting with lifelong friends. She was truly the life of the party — always making everyone laugh with her quick wit, funny comments, and zest for life.
Ms. Billie loved spending time with her IOP group, who became like family to her. She especially enjoyed cokes, spaghetti, cozy sweatpants, her plants, and watching Cops and American Idol. In recent years, she was blessed to travel to places like Broken Bow, the beach, and Hot Springs, making cherished memories with her family along the way. In her final years, she found comfort and peace surrounded by the love and devotion of her children, especially the care and companionship of her daughter, Veronica.
She was preceded In death by her mom, Shirley Joann Corrent; and father, AJ Corrent.
Survivors include her children, Charlie Perry; Ellis Hunt and wife, Alexis, of West Monroe; and Veronica Lowry and husband, Taylor, of West Monroe; her sister, Mary Sue Thrash; brother; Jay Corrent; grandchildren, Trey, Cason, Chandler, Caden, Landon, and Henry; along with other relatives and dear friends who loved her dearly.
Pallbearers will be Ellis Hunt, Taylor Lowry, Jet Tarver, Benson Kinney, and Cole Sullivan, and Allen Perritt.
The family would like to express their heartfelt gratitude to all those who cared for Ms. Billie throughout her life, including Dr. Frank Weinholt, Dr. Emily Kinney, Mike Smith (her IOP counselor), and the many dedicated home health professionals who supported her with compassion.
